Yusuke Edamoto is a researcher whose work sits at the fascinating intersection of computer vision, privacy, and human perception. His most notable contribution, "Visual Place Recognition From Eye Reflection" (2021), explores a novel privacy vulnerability: the ability to reconstruct a person’s surroundings from the corneal reflections captured in high-resolution facial images. This work, which has garnered 6 citations, highlights how the increasing quality of consumer cameras introduces unforeseen risks, as the human eye can inadvertently act as a lens, leaking environmental information.
